相关文章

MySQL 中的 FOREIGN KEY 约束:确保数据完整性的关键

在 MySQL 数据库中,FOREIGN KEY(外键)约束是一种非常重要的机制,它可以帮助我们确保数据的完整性和一致性。那么,FOREIGN KEY 约束究竟是什么呢?让我们一起来深入了解一下。 一、什么是 FOREIGN KEY 约束&…

DeepSpeed笔记--利用Accelerate实现DeepSpeed加速

1--参考文档 Accelerate官方文档 acceleratedeepspeed多机多卡训练-适用集群环境 DeepSpeed & Accelerate 2--安装过程 # 安装accelerate pip install accelerate pip install importlib-metadata # 获取默认配置文件 python -c "from accelerate.utils import wr…

C#的Socket编程细节

目录 Socket中的Accept 步骤1:创建并绑定服务端套接字 步骤2:接受连接请求 步骤3:与客户端通信 步骤4:关闭套接字 注意事项 Socket中的Connected 使用Connected属性 客户端检查连接状态 服务端检查连接状态 注意事项 S…

江科大笔记—LED闪烁 LED流水灯 蜂鸣器

LED闪烁& LED流水灯& 蜂鸣器 LED闪烁 第一步,使用RCC开启GPIO时钟。 第二步,使用GPIO_Init函数初始化GPIO。 第三步,使用输出或输入的函数控制GPIO口。 RCC库函数 GPIO库函数(先了解这些) GPIO的8种输入模…

【面试题】软件测试实习(含答案)

软件测试实习常见面试题,主要是功能测试相关的基础问题 目录 一、软件测试基础 1、介绍一下你最近的项目,以及工作职责 2、软件项目的测试流程? 3、黑盒测试与白盒测试的区别? 4、黑盒测试常见的设计方法?怎么理解等价类方法和边界值方法 1&…

创建javaWeb项目(详细版本)2021年2月

1、新建一个java项目 2、点击工程名称,找到add framework support,并点击 建好如图 3、分别在工程目录下创建resourse文件夹和web目录下创建classes和lib文件夹 建好如图 4、file找到 project structure 5、选中resourse 将其mark as sources 6、路径改…

前缀和(包括一维和二维)

前缀和 什么是前缀和?用在哪里?有什么好处? 前缀和是在反复求一个序列中不同区间处的元素之和。 例如有以下一个数组:1,2,3,4,5 我们要求a[2]~a[4](不包括a[2]&#xff0…

零基础教你如何开发webman应用插件

0X07 发布插件应用 插件应用发布地址 https://www.workerman.net/app/create。填写好发布相关信息 0X08 上传源码zip文件 提交完成之后等待官方审核就可以啦! 0X09 安装插件 应用插件安装有两种方式 在插件市场安装 进入官方管理后台webman-admin 的应用插件页点击…

大数据Hologres(二):Hologres 快速入门

文章目录 Hologres 快速入门 一、资源领取 二、入门体验 1、创建数据库 2、创建表 3、导入示例数据 4、查询表中数据 Hologres 快速入门 一、资源领取 领取链接: 阿里云免费试用 - 阿里云 (aliyun.com) 二、入门体验 1、创建数据库 进入Hologres管理控制…

A股突破3000,连续大涨,公司国庆假放10天

关注▲洋洋科创星球▲一起成长! 庆祝A股突破3000,连续大涨,也不知道老板抽了什么风,公司今天开始放国庆假了,连休10天,哈哈哈哈哈哈。 27号开始放国庆假,连休10,刺激。 中秋国庆这一…

【C++算法】5.双指针_乘最多水的容器

文章目录 题目链接:题目描述:解法C 算法代码:图解: 题目链接: 11.盛最多水的容器 题目描述: 解法 7x749 解法一:暴力枚举 输入:[1,8,6,2&#xf…

切面编程AOP:一种优雅的编程范式

目录 1. 引言 2. 什么是AOP? 3. AOP的核心概念 3.1 切面(Aspect) 3.2 通知(Advice) 3.3 切点(Pointcut) 3.4 目标对象(Target Object) 3.5 代理(Prox…

Three.js粒子系统与特效

目录 粒子系统基础常见粒子系统特效粒子系统基础 基础的粒子系统 使用THREE.ParticleSystem和THREE.ParticleBasicMaterial实现: // 导入Three.js库 import * as THREE from three

安装 Nacos 启动报错 java.lang.IllegalArgumentException: db.num is null

java.io.IOException: java.lang.IllegalArgumentException: db.num is nullat com.alibaba.nacos.config.server.service.datasource.ExternalDataSourceServiceImpl.reload(ExternalDataSourceServiceImpl.java:130)解决办法: 编辑 startup.cmd 文件 找到 set MO…

python学习记录4

目录 (1)位运算 (2)运算的优先级 (1)位运算 位运算是将数字看做二进制数来运算的&#xff0c;位运算分为按位与&#xff08;&&#xff09;、按位或&#xff08;|&#xff09;、按位异或&#xff08;^&#xff09;、按位取反(~)。还有移位运算&#xff08;左移位<<、…

Vue3 路由props配置:让页面通信更高效

嗨&#xff0c;小伙伴们&#xff01;今天咱们聊聊Vue3中一个超实用的功能——路由props配置&#xff01;通过这个小小的配置&#xff0c;你可以让你的应用页面通信变得更加高效便捷。无论是新手小白还是进阶玩家&#xff0c;这篇教程都能帮你快速掌握这一技能。话不多说&#x…

【Linux】修改用户名用户家目录

0、锁定旧用户登录 如果旧用户olduser正在运行中是无法操作的&#xff0c;需要先禁用用户登录&#xff0c;然后杀掉所有此用户的进程。 1. 使用 usermod 命令禁用用户 这将锁定用户账户&#xff0c;使其无法登录&#xff1a; sudo usermod -L olduser2. 停止用户的进程 如…

如何通过 GitHub Actions 使用 SSH 自动化部署到阿里云 ECS 实例

在现代应用开发中,自动化部署是提升开发效率的重要工具之一。GitHub Actions 是 GitHub 提供的一种自动化工具,允许开发者在代码推送时自动执行一些任务,比如测试、构建和部署。本文将介绍如何通过 GitHub Actions 使用 SSH 登录到阿里云 ECS 实例,实现自动化部署。 场景设…

二叉搜索树的介绍、模拟实现二叉搜索树、leetcode---根据二叉树创建字符串、leetcode---二叉树的最近公共祖先等的介绍

文章目录 前言一、二叉搜索树的介绍二、模拟实现二叉搜索树三、leetcode---根据二叉树创建字符串四、leetcode---二叉树的最近公共祖先总结 前言 二叉搜索树的介绍、模拟实现二叉搜索树、leetcode—根据二叉树创建字符串、leetcode—二叉树的最近公共祖先等的介绍 一、二叉搜索…

docker pull报错:dial tcp: no such host

有一段时间没用docker了&#xff0c;今天使用docker下载镜像竟然报错&#xff0c;而且是莫名其妙的错误&#xff0c;奔走相告&#xff0c;避免后来者踩坑&#xff01; Error response from daemon: Get "https://mirror.aliyuncs.com/v2/": dial tcp: lookup mirror…